Seated Cross Leg Glute Stretch
4 steps Updated 29/08/2026
Seated Cross Leg Glute Stretch is a bodyweight exercise targeting Glutes (Gluteus Maximus, Gluteus Medius) using Yoga Mat.
How to perform it
- Sit on the floor with your legs extended straight in front of you.
- Bend your right knee and cross your right leg over your left thigh and lightly bend your left knee placing your left foot flat on the floor.
- Keeping your back straight, lower your chest towards your crossed leg, reaching your hands stright to the floor to deepen the stretch.
- Hold the stretch for 15-30 seconds, feeling the stretch in your right glute. Slowly release and return to the starting position. Repeat on the left side.
